Output 48670c8a0d9c6a8d6fe4398847fc31a1242c7b568f786c6dfb05fa64c2f76421:1

value
980638464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62afbbef4f8023d5e13960cbbf6d46ccb8fcbb06 OP_EQUAL
address
3AgpfZf8Zd6HBPFagBo38cWXrFXURUAt5m
transaction
48670c8a0d9c6a8d6fe4398847fc31a1242c7b568f786c6dfb05fa64c2f76421
confirmations
383563
spent
true